Weiya Xue is a scholar working on Plant Science, Genetics and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Weiya Xue has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 2.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Plant Science, 12 papers in Genetics and 3 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Weiya Xue’s work include Genetic Mapping and Diversity in Plants and Animals (12 papers), Rice Cultivation and Yield Improvement (11 papers) and Gamma-Aminobutyric Acid Metabolism in Plants (6 papers). Weiya Xue is often cited by papers focused on Genetic Mapping and Diversity in Plants and Animals (12 papers), Rice Cultivation and Yield Improvement (11 papers) and Gamma-Aminobutyric Acid Metabolism in Plants (6 papers). Weiya Xue coll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Sweden. Weiya Xue's co-authors include Yongzhong Xing, Qifa Zhang, Caiguo Xu, Xianghua Li, Hongju Zhou, Yu Zhao, Lei Wang, Sibin Yu, Weijiang Tang and Xiaoyu Weng and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Genetics, PLoS ONE and The Plant Cell.
